Executive Assistant at Summit Recruitment and Search – Summit Recruitment and Search Kenya Job Details
This role will provide comprehensive support to the CEO ensuring smooth alignment of executive priorities, strategic initiatives and daily operations. Serving as a gatekeeper, liaison, and strategic partner, they will support the CEO and senior leadership by handling administrative, logistical, and communication tasks with efficiency and confidentiality.
Key Responsibilities:
- Proactively manage the CEO’s complex schedule, prioritize meetings, speaking engagements, and global travel, while anticipating conflicts and optimizing time for strategic priorities across multiple time zones.
- Draft, review, and send emails, reports, and presentations on behalf of the CEO, screen and prioritize incoming communications, and act as the first point of contact for internal and external stakeholders.
- Organize executive meetings (Board, Leadership Team, Investors), prepare agendas, briefing documents, and post-meeting action trackers, and attend meetings when needed to take minutes and follow up on deliverables.
- Handle end-to-end travel arrangements, including flights, hotels, visas, and transportation, ensuring seamless itineraries and coordinating with security teams for high-profile travel.
- Track, reconcile, and submit timely expense reports for the CEO, ensuring compliance with company policies and managing reimbursements.
- Assist with research, data analysis, and preparation for key initiatives such as partnerships and investor relations and help track KPIs and business performance in alignment with strategic goals.
- Handle sensitive information (financials, legal matters, personnel issues) with the utmost confidentiality and discretion, ensuring all communications and decisions are handled securely.
Qualifications:
- Degree in Business Administration or a related field
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- High pro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ook)
-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
